			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img class="alignright size-full wp-image-239" title="Junk-Yards-In-Colorado" src="http://www.junkyardsincolorado.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/11/Junk-Yards-In-Colorado.jpg" alt="" width="310" height="250" />There usually happens a time when your own vehicle really needs a newer part. Many things can happen on the road and off the road, and quite often it can be your failing or some other driver. It&#8217;s possible to hit a curb when parking your car and your rim would need a replacing, or you could leave your car or truck parked at the supermarket, and some visitor could smack your mirror with the shopping cart accidently.</p>
<p>No matter the reason you must find an effective alternative and really fast and preferably inexpensive. The worst case scenario is when you have a classic model, or an older type and to get a new part turns into a major problem &#8211; almost certainly common shops don’t have these parts anymore, and also the scarce ones which do will ask for a lot of cash for the coveted detail. Introducing a junk yard. Most people would point out “meh, those are second-hand or half-busted”, and it is normally true, although the people who’ve visited car junk yard will definitely rate it a thumbs up. Have a look at these few junk yards in Denver, CO and a couple of details that participants on yelp.com and citysearch.com thought about these:</p>
